Product Overview
The AFM0200 is a micro thermal mass flow sensor specifically developed for precise measurement of small gas flows. Utilizing an independently developed MEMS mass flow chip, it accurately calculates gas mass flow by measuring resistance changes. This sensor offers intuitive readings, high precision, stability, resistance to extreme temperatures, good linearity, and fast response times. With built-in temperature compensation and a compact design, the AFM0200 is ideal for various applications requiring gas flow measurement, including gas detectors, air samplers, sweep and cooling flow management in wire bonding machines, and confirmation of adsorption for micro electronic and optical components. It undergoes rigorous factory calibration, providing direct flow output to reduce user costs and development complexity.

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Description |
|---|---|
| Model | AFM0200A00 |
| Flow Range | -3 ~ 3L/min |
| Accuracy | 5%F.S. |
| Repeatability | 2%F.S. |
| Response Time | 100ms |
| Output Mode | Voltage Output: 1~5V |
| Power Supply | External Power Supply 1224V DC |
| Power Consumption | 0.85W (typical) |
| Maximum Working Pressure | 0.1~0.2MPa |
| Standard Calibration Gas | Air (25, 1 standard atmosphere) |
| Working Temperature | -10~+60 |
| Product Weight | 7.7g |
| Pin Definitions | 1 (Red): Power, 2 (Black): GND, 3 (Yellow): Analog Output |

Product Output
4.1 Voltage Output
The AFM0200 features analog voltage output. The relationship between voltage and flow is as follows:
Formula: X = Voltage (V), Y = Liters per minute (slm)
Voltage to Flow Conversion:
- Positive: If output voltage is 3V and 4.5V, use formula: Y=(X-3) / 2.5. Otherwise, use formula: Y=(X-4.5)* 4.8 + 0.6
- Reverse: If output voltage is 1.5V and 3V, use formula: Y=(X-3) / 2.5. Otherwise, use formula: Y=(X-1.5)* 4.8 - 0.6
